Synerise is a Polish deep-tech company founded in 2013 by Jarosław Królewski, Krzysztof Kochmański, and Miłosz Baluś. Headquartered in Kraków, Poland, with additional offices in Warsaw, San Francisco, and Dubai, the company specializes in AI-driven behavioral modeling and big data solutions. The firm operates a B2B SaaS platform that enables clients to collect, store, process, and analyze heterogeneous data in real-time, supported by artificial intelligence and a low-code/no-code interface.
The company's core offering is the Synerise AI Growth Cloud, an ecosystem designed to unify customer data from various online and offline channels to create comprehensive, real-time 360-degree customer profiles. This allows businesses to automate marketing communications and personalize customer experiences across multiple channels, including email, SMS, web, mobile apps, and social media. The platform's proprietary technologies include Terrarium, a high-speed database for real-time data processing, and Cleora, an AI engine for identifying significant events and making predictions. Synerise serves clients in sectors such as e-commerce, retail, finance, and telecommunications, helping them to understand customer behavior, predict trends, and optimize business operations.
CEO Jarosław Królewski, a programmer and academic researcher at AGH University of Science and Technology, has a background in computer science and sociology, which has influenced the company's scientific approach to technology. The founding team also includes Krzysztof Kochmański as Chief Design Officer, who has a background in mechatronics and robotics, and Miłosz Baluś as CTO. The company has received significant recognition, including being named a Microsoft Partner of the Year multiple times and listed by the Financial Times as one of Europe's fastest-growing technology companies.
Synerise has raised a total of $31.5 million over several funding rounds. A major Series B round in May 2022 raised $23 million, led by Carpathian Partners. This was followed by a Series B+ round of $8.5 million in July 2024, led by VTEX, a commerce platform, which also initiated a strategic technological partnership to integrate Synerise's AI models into its own offerings. This funding is intended to fuel the company's expansion into new markets, particularly the US, and further develop its deep-tech platform.
